Next we moved over to the UCLA Inverted Fountain, which was rather impressive. The story goes that when the developers were given the task of adding a water feature to the campus, they had to get creative, as a wind tunnel in Franz Hall Court would have sprayed the fountain’s water in all directions, so they came up with a brilliant solution of having the water fall down versus spraying up.

We ended our grad photo session in front of the amazing Royce Hall. The twin-towered front remains the best known UCLA landmark.. Being one of the four original buildings on UCLA’s Westwood campus, there was no way that we could not end our session here.
